Shirley J. Hess 1936-2009
Article Photos
NILES - Shirley J. Hess, 73, 155 E. State St., passed away peacefully at 8:35 p.m. Sunday, Nov. 29, 2009, at Hospice House, following a short illness with cancer.
She was born June 19, 1936 in Garrison, W.Va., a daughter of Emil and Effie Moore Wiseman.
Shirley retired in 1999 after working 20 years as a hostess and waitress at Alberini's Restaurant in Niles. She was a member of Niles First Presbyterian Church and enjoyed listening to Elvis Presley music, family activities and playing cards and bingo with her friends at Central Park Apartments.
She is survived by two sons, Mark (Lori) Hess and William (Susan) Hess, and two daughters, Terri (JonPaul) Jones and Beverly Peigowski, all of Niles; nine grandchildren, George, Crystal, Matthew, Jennifer, Warren, Taylor, Elizabeth, Emily and Ethan; eight great-grandchildren; a brother, Terry (Mary) Wiseman of St. Augustine, Fla.; and a sister, Carol (Kenneth) Thompson of Ashburn, Va.
She was preceded in death by her parents and a grandson, Jason Tutoki.
Calling hours will be 5 to 7 p.m. today at the Holeton-Yuhasz Funeral Home. Funeral services will be 11 a.m. Wednesday at the funeral home, officiated by the Rev. Henry Pearce. Burial will be at Niles City Cemetery. Memorial contributions may be made to Hospice of the Valley.
